Samsung Instinct HD Outed In Sprint Newsletter
Sep 11, 2009, 8:55 AM by Eric M. Zeman
Sprint recently revealed a few details about the forthcoming Samsung Instinct HD in a newsletter that was sent to Sprint Premier Connection subscribers. In the newsletter, Sprint notes that the Instinct HD has a 3.2-inch touch display, a 5 megapixel camera, improved visual voicemail and an improved browser. This phone hasn't been officially unveiled, and Sprint didn't disclose when it would become available or how much it would cost. No other details were provided.
